Boxing Update: Middendorf Launches United Boxers Venture

Chris Middendorf has launched United Boxers, a new promotional company which will present its first event on Friday, April 15th at the Maryland Sportsplex in Millersville, just south of Baltimore.

The inaugural United Boxers event will showcase an All-Star Card of the area’s best young talent including cruiserweight Russ “The Hammer” Shiflett, 9-0-1 (5KO’s), who will be featured in the main event.

Also battling will be fellow undefeated prospects; welterweight Emmanuel “The Tranzformer” Taylor , 10-0-0 (8KO’s), welterweight James “Keep’em Sleepin” Stevenson, 13-0-0 (10KO’s) and cruiserweight “Slick” Nick Kisner, 7-0-0 (5KO’s).

Rounding out the all-action event will be longtime Baltimore area favorites; super middleweight Mike “The Persecutor” Paschall, 21-2-1 (4KO’s), junior middleweight Ishmael “The Arsenal” Irvin, 15-2-4 (7KO’s) and middleweight Jesse “The Beast” Nicklow, 20-1-3 (7KO’s).

Said Middendorf, “We have six events planned for the Maryland area with the next one on May 21st at the Maryland Sportsplex and then every other month in Maryland . We will also be promoting several events in Washington D.C. and Virginia.”

“In all of the shows that I have done, my goal has been to showcase the best talent in the area together with world class talent from across the country. The fans see their home grown young stars as well as being exposed to some talented athletes that they may not know. And if done correctly, it grows the fan base for all of the boxers. This is obviously an important part of the approach of United Boxers,” continued Middendorf.

In addition to the first two United Boxers events, Middendorf will also be busy this spring outside of Maryland with former world title challenger Demetrius “The Gladiator” Hopkins facing Brad Solomon on ESPN2’s Friday Night Fights from the Hard Rock Hotel and Hotel in Fort Lauderdale, Florida.

On April 2nd, Middendorf will be in France with world ranked contender Giovanni Lorenzo challenging WBA Middleweight Champion Hassan N’Dam N’Jikam.
